Advertisement

配置CentOS本地yum源、阿里云yum源和163yum源,并设置优先级

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本教程详细介绍如何在CentOS系统中配置并使用本地yum源及来自阿里云和网易的在线yum源,并说明如何调整各源的优先级以优化软件包管理。 本段落主要介绍了如何在CentOS系统上配置本地yum源、阿里云yum源以及163源,并详细讲解了如何设置这些yum源的优先级。通过具体的示例代码,文章为读者提供了详尽的操作指南,对于学习或工作中需要使用到相关技术的人来说具有很高的参考价值。希望有需求的朋友能从中学到所需的知识和技巧。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CentOSyumyum163yum
    优质
    本教程详细介绍如何在CentOS系统中配置并使用本地yum源及来自阿里云和网易的在线yum源,并说明如何调整各源的优先级以优化软件包管理。 本段落主要介绍了如何在CentOS系统上配置本地yum源、阿里云yum源以及163源,并详细讲解了如何设置这些yum源的优先级。通过具体的示例代码,文章为读者提供了详尽的操作指南,对于学习或工作中需要使用到相关技术的人来说具有很高的参考价值。希望有需求的朋友能从中学到所需的知识和技巧。
  • CentOSyum
    优质
    本教程详细介绍了如何在CentOS系统中配置和使用本地YUM仓库,包括创建、配置及测试过程,帮助用户实现高效便捷的操作系统管理和软件包更新。 本段落档详细介绍了在CentOS系统上配置本地yum源的操作步骤。
  • CentOS 7Yum.mhtml
    优质
    本指南详细介绍了如何在CentOS 7系统上设置和使用本地Yum仓库,涵盖创建、配置及测试过程,帮助用户实现软件包管理的自给自足。 在CentOS7上配置本地yum源的步骤如下: 1. 准备镜像文件:首先需要下载一个包含所有软件包及其依赖关系的ISO镜像文件。 2. 创建目录结构:使用mkdir命令创建存放rpm包及repodata信息的目录,例如: ``` mkdir -p /path/to/localrepo/CentOS7/os/x86_64 ``` 3. 复制iso内容:将下载好的CentOS ISO镜像挂载到上述指定路径下,并将其内部的所有文件复制出来。 4. 生成repodata信息:利用createrepo命令在本地yum源目录中创建元数据,执行如下操作: ``` createrepo /path/to/localrepo/CentOS7 ``` 5. 配置yum使用本地仓库:编辑/etc/yum.repos.d/目录下的.repo文件(如CentOS-Base.repo),设置baseurl为指向本地yum源的路径,并确保enabled=1。 6. 测试配置是否生效:通过运行`yum repolist all`命令查看已启用及禁用的所有repository。如果成功,你将看到新添加的本地仓库信息。 以上步骤可以帮助你在CentOS7系统中顺利设置并使用本地yum源进行软件包管理。
  • CentOS 7 yum 的代码方法
    优质
    本篇文章介绍了如何通过编写Shell脚本的方式,在CentOS 7操作系统中设置阿里云的yum源,实现软件包管理的加速与优化。 在Linux系统管理中,YUM(Yellowdog Updater, Modified)是CentOS、RHEL等基于RPM包管理的Linux发行版常用的软件包管理器,能够方便地完成软件包的安装、更新和卸载操作。使用阿里云镜像源可以显著提高下载速度,尤其是对于大型软件包或更新时。以下详细介绍了如何在CentOS7系统中配置阿里云YUM源的步骤: 1. **打开YUM配置文件夹** 你需要进入`/etc/yum.repos.d`目录,这是存放YUM源配置文件的地方。通过执行以下命令来切换到该目录: ```bash cd /etc/yum.repos.d ``` 2. **下载阿里云YUM源repo文件** 使用`wget`命令下载阿里云提供的CentOS-7.repo配置文件。如果系统中没有`wget`,需要先安装: ```bash yum -y install wget ``` 然后,下载repo文件: ```bash wget http://mirrors.aliyun.com/repo/Centos-7.repo ``` 3. **备份原有YUM源** 为了防止误操作,建议备份现有的YUM源配置文件。创建一个名为`repo_bak`的目录,然后将所有的`.repo`文件移动到该目录: ```bash mkdir repo_bak mv *.repo repo_bak ``` 4. **替换CentOS-Base.repo** 下载并替换新的CentOS-Base.repo文件,确保使用阿里云的源: ```bash w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o ``` 5. **清除YUM缓存** 清理YUM的旧缓存,以便加载新的源信息: ```bash yum clean all ``` 6. **生成新缓存** 创建新的YUM缓存,这样系统就能使用阿里云源来获取软件包信息: ```bash yum makecache ``` 完成以上步骤后,你的CentOS7系统就已经成功配置了阿里云YUM源。接下来,无论是安装新的软件包还是更新现有软件,都会从阿里云的服务器获取,从而提高下载速度和稳定性。 注意定期检查阿里云的YUM源是否是最新的以及是否仍提供所需的服务。镜像源可能会随着时间和版本的变化而发生变化。此外,如果遇到网络问题或服务器维护可能会影响YUM操作效率,这时可以考虑切换到其他可用的镜像源。
  • Shell脚自动化生成Yum仓库与163的CentOS 5/6/7 Yum
    优质
    本教程详解如何利用Shell脚本自动构建本地Yum仓库,并配置阿里云及网易的CentOS 5/6/7专用Yum镜像源,提升系统更新和安装效率。 对于离线环境下的依赖包安装,我们可以选择设置本地yum源或者直接下载所需的rpm包。运行脚本 `./yum_source_change.sh` 时需要提供两个参数:第一个参数为2表示执行yum源的安装操作;第二个参数是镜像文件的全路径(例如 `/path/to/centos.iso`)。 具体的操作选项如下: 1. 使用ftp源进行安装。 2. 使用yum源进行安装。 3. 设置阿里云CentOS-5.repo配置。 4. 设置阿里云CentOS-6.repo配置。 5. 设置阿里云CentOS-7.repo配置。 6. 设置网易的CentOS5-Base-163.repo配置。 7. 设置网易的CentOS6-Base-163.repo配置。 8. 设置网易的CentOS7-Base-163.repo配置。
  • CentOS 6 Yum
    优质
    本指南详细介绍了如何在CentOS 6系统中配置Yum源,包括添加新仓库、替换默认源以及优化网络下载速度等步骤。 CentOS 6_64 Yum配置一键搞定。
  • 与EPEL的Yum文件.zip
    优质
    本资源包提供了一份详细的指南和配置文件,帮助用户解决在使用阿里云服务器时,安装EPEL仓库过程中遇到的yum源配置问题。 在CentOS 7系统中配置Yum源可以通过编辑或创建相应的配置文件来完成。通常情况下,默认的yum源可能因为网络原因导致下载速度慢或者不稳定,这时候可以考虑更换为国内镜像站点或其他高速稳定的第三方yum源。 首先需要备份原有的yum源配置文件: ``` sudo c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.bak ``` 然后可以通过下载新的CentOS官方或第三方提供的repo文件,或者手动编辑/etc/yum.repos.d/目录下的相关repo配置文件。 以阿里云的yum源为例,在该目录下创建一个名为`CentOS7-aliyun.repo`的新文件,并输入如下内容: ```ini [base] name=CentOS-$releasever - Base - Aliyun mirrorlist=http://mirrors.aliyun.com/repo/Centos-7.repo gpgcheck=0 #addons仓库配置 [addons] name=CentOS-$releasever - Addons - Aliyun mirrorlist=http://mirrors.aliyun.com/repo/Centos-7.repo gpgcheck=0 #extras仓库配置 [extras] name=CentOS-$releasever - Extras - Aliyun mirrorlist=http://mirrors.aliyun.com/repo/Centos-7.repo gpgcheck=0 #更新工具与存储库的源码包,主要用于yum update时使用。 [updates] name=CentOS-$releasever - Updates - Aliyun mirrorlist=http://mirrors.aliyun.com/repo/Centos-7.repo gpgcheck=0 ``` 完成上述步骤后,运行`sudo yum clean all && sudo yum makecache fast`命令来更新yum缓存。 通过以上方法可以有效提高CentOS 7系统中Yum安装软件包的速度和稳定性。